Output 103a6ed3c97e28af0021775a76bbf1b300480117769a82040dedccf5d146d64d:0

value
678431766
script pubkey
OP_0 OP_PUSHBYTES_20 d84609cf78d9e10bae8d3aa763b5a3b51425fb6c
address
bc1qmprqnnmcm8ssht5d82nk8ddrk52zt7mvcpp9zm
transaction
103a6ed3c97e28af0021775a76bbf1b300480117769a82040dedccf5d146d64d
spent
true